Tropical Weather Outlook
NWS National Hurricane Center Miami FL
1100 PM PDT Tue Aug 18 2026
For the eastern and central North Pacific east of 180 longitude:
Active Systems:
The National Hurricane Center is issuing advisories on Hurricane
Lala, located several hundred miles west of Kauai, Hawaii.
South-Southwest of Mexico:
An area of low pressure is forecast to form several hundred miles
south-southwest of the coast of southern Mexico around the end of
the week. Gradual development of this system is likely thereafter,
and a tropical depression is expected to form this weekend while the
system moves generally west-northwestward, remaining well offshore
of Mexico.
* Formation chance through 48 hours...low...near 0 percent.
* Formation chance through 7 days...high...80 percent.
Central Pacific:
A tropical wave located well to the east-southeast of the Hawaiian
Islands is showing some signs of organization. Environmental
conditions appear conducive for further development of this system,
and a tropical depression is likely to form within a few days while
the system moves generally westward across the western portion of
the east Pacific and into the Central Pacific.
* Formation chance through 48 hours...medium...50 percent.
* Formation chance through 7 days...high...80 percent.
